I recently picked up the Tactical variant on trade, and while having minimal time to fondle / get behind it as of yet, I am very happy with it.

The finish is excellent, and the rifle balances very well. It's almost a shame to think about modifying it and throwing off the current setup. One thing I WILL change, is the nordic tactical compensator, while very effective at eliminating muzzle rise is BRUTAL on the ears, even for the shooter. I had earplugs in last weekend, and my ears are still ringing.

Chambered in .223 Remington or 5.56mm NATO (depending on customer and application), the 16″ 410 SS barrel features a 1:8 twist with a mid-length gas system.

I think what the upgraded benefit is that the barrel is a different twist rate and that it is a Stainless Steel option.
